H. L. Miller Cantorial School and College of Jewish Music of The Jewish Theological Seminary (JTS) presents Craig Taubman in Concert, at which singer-songwriter Craig Taubman will debut an original liturgical composition by JTS student Gil Ezring.
Through a workshop at JTS, Gil was chosen to collaborate with Craig on a new song to be premiered at this concert. Gil wrote an original piece over the summer, “Shalom Rav,” and together they edited and polished it through a long process informed by Craig’s expertise and Gil’s creative energy. It will be performed for the first time at JTS on Thursday.
